Re: Deferring command-line options


On Wed, Nov 17, 2010 at 10:18 AM, Joseph S. Myers
<joseph@codesourcery.com> wrote:
> This patch implements a general system for command-line options to be
> deferred for handling after the main sequence of calls to option
> handlers.
>
> The purpose of this is to separate those parts of option
> handling/initialization that are best kept out of the driver
> (involving RTL, registers, etc.) from those that can be shared with
> the driver.
>
> The deferred handling goes in a new file opts-global.c. ?The intended
> division is: opts-common.c for general option-handling code not
> involving global data or the details of individual options, opts.c for
> code relating to details of individual options but not involving
> global data or state not readily available in the driver,
> opts-global.c for code depending on global state or state not
> available in the driver in ways that are hard to remove. ?There are
> still plenty of cases of options in opts.c using global data that will
> need addressing in one way or another; the ones moved in this patch
> are the ones for which it seems clearest that moving them is the right
> approach.
>
> Right now the deferred handling of common options is called from
> toplev.c immediately after decode_options. ?(None of the options in
> question is an optimization option so we don't need to worry about
> handling them in other calls to decode_options.) ?This may move
> elsewhere as the option initialization in toplev.c:process_options
> gets better integrated with that in opts.c:finish_options.
>
> Deferred handling is already used by at least C-family and Fortran
> front ends for some preprocessor options; this patch doesn't do
> anything with that although it would probably make sense to move it to
> the new mechanism.
>
> The deferred options are stored in a VEC; where multiple sets of
> deferred options are useful, different options can specify different
> Var settings along with Defer in the .opt file. ?However, the
> gcc_options field is declared as void *. ?This is because declaring
> VEC types also defines inline functions, which need symbols from
> vec.c, and options.h is included in tm.h which is included in target
> code and miscellaneous host programs such as gcov which don't use
> vec.c. ?If uses of tm.h in code built for the target are eliminated,
> it may then make sense to revisit this, add vec.o and ggc-none.o to
> all miscellaneous host programs not using them (it seems reasonable to
> consider VECs generic infrastructure it's OK to link into all
> programs), and give the fields their proper VEC types.
>
